Afrika Zibetkatze vs Mongalla Free-tailed Bat
Civettictis civetta compared with Mops demonstrator
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Afrika Zibetkatze | Mongalla Free-tailed Bat |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Tier) | Animalia (Tier)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ordatiere) | Chordata (Chordatiere)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Säugetiere) | Mammalia (Säugetiere) |
| Order | Carnivora (Raubtiere) | Chiroptera (Fledertiere) |
| Family | Viverridae | Molossidae |
| Genus | Civettictis | Mops |
| Species | Civettictis civetta | Mops demonstrator |
Evolutionary Relationship
Afrika Zibetkatze and Mongalla Free-tailed Bat share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Säugetiere)
